It is a fact that the Prado Museum is one of the most famous art galleries in the world. Do you want to know why? Join me at this tour and let me help you to understand it!! Since I was a kid, I have always loved the Prado Museum. This is one of the reasons I decided to become an official guide. Even if art is not your cup of tea or you are not very familiarized with Spanish painters, you will be delighted by the Prado and will recognize many of the paintings you can find there. Firstly, we will discover the main streets and monuments of the oldest area of Madrid (the surroundings of the Royal Palace, Plaza Mayor, Puerta del Sol. . . ) and then, we will visit the main art gallery in Spain, where we will see the masterpieces by El Greco, Velázquez or Goya, learn about their importance and know about some anecdotes that you will not find on the books. Let me show you this beautiful city and its cultural heart, let me show you the Prado!!

-We begin the tour at Opera House, where I will introduce the history of Madrid. -Pass by the Oriente Square -Stop outside the Royal Palace -If there is not a mass, we can have a look at the inside of the Almudena Cathedral -Quick stop at the Arab Wall -Explore The Habsburgs Quarter -Stop at Plaza de la Villa -Pass by Calle del Codo -Have a look at the San Miguel Market (food market) -Stop at Plaza Mayor, the main square of Madrid. -Stop at Puerta del Sol -Pass by the Parliament -Visit the inside of the Prado Museum - Guided Tour to see the masterpieces by El Greco, Velázquez or Goya The itinerary can be adapted to traveller's interests: do no hesitate to contact me for a customized tour.
